Joseph BROSSEAU was born 3 May 1739 in La Prairie, Canada, New France

Joseph BROSSEAU was the child of Joseph BROSSEAU   and   Françoise PINSONNEAULT and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Pierre-Hebert BROSSEAU (BROUSSEAU) and Barbe BOURBON (maternal)  Jacques PINSONNEAULT dit LAFLEUR and Marie-Elisabeth BOURASSA

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Joseph  married  Marguerite BEAUVAIS 29 October 1764 in La Prairie, Province of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marguerite BEAUVAIS  was born 18 December 1739 in La Prairie, Québec, Canada (St-Philippe) (St-Jean-François-Régis) (La Nativité).  Marguerite died 20 August 1821 in La Prairie, Québec, Canada (St-Philippe) (St-Jean-François-Régis) (La Nativité).  Marguerite was the child of Joseph BEAUVAIS and Marie-Marguerite LEMIEUX.

Joseph BROSSEAU died 16 March 1805 in La Prairie,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
